So for Rock we’re starting off with my favorite band, The Beatles, and a song that y’all should listen to is “Here, There and Everywhere” from their Revolver album. This song is more love based and in case you ever want a song that reminds you of your partner then this one here is definitely a good one.
For Jazz, I’d thought I would recommend a classic and that would be “Dreamsville” by Wes Montgomery Trio and this one is an absolute classic. Nice, soft and just something in case you want to relax.

For R&B, this song “Untitled (How Does It Feel)” by the late and great D’Angelo off his Voodoo album is one I'm sure you guys may have heard of. In my opinion, this song is in the top 10 greatest R&B songs produced and released and needs to be heard a lot more.

For Pop, we’re going back to the last Micheal Jackson album in 2014 to give a listen to "Love Never Felt So Good” featuring Justin Timberlake off the XSACPE album. Never had I expected a crossover between the two but regardless the song sounds amazing and just gets me all happy listening to it.
For Rap, I thought I'd go more modern and go with the song “drive ME crazy!” by Lil Yachty and Diana Gordon. Starting off the song I just felt relaxed and just grooved along to the song especially when it came to the chorus, I just gave a shocked but happy reaction to it.
Finally, for the Soul genre, I'll go with something of a familiar song that you’ve heard but don’t know the song itself. That is “Let Me Prove My Love You” by The Main Ingredient. Fun fact about this song, this song was sampled in Alicia Keys’s “You Don’t Know My Name”. This song is just pure vibes the first time I heard it and was just in shock listening to the melody and lyrics but in general it’s an amazing song.
